Joel Perrault Re-Signs with the Coyotes

By fanster.com, August 9th, 2007 11:41 AM

Center Joel Perrault re-signs with the Phoenix Coyotes today for a one-year deal. Last season, he played 31 games with the Coyotes and scored two goals with three assists.

During the 2006-2007 campaign, the Coyotes placed Perrault on waivers where the St. Louis Blues claimed him. Then, the Blues released Perrault only to come back to Phoenix to finish the season with the franchise.

For both of his small stints with the Coyotes, he didn’t make too much of a dent in the offensive production. At best, he is a third - fourth line center that all teams need to round out their roster. However, it will be up to him to show the fans and the front office, exactly what he can do.
